Warning: file_get_contents(/data/phpspider/zhask/data//catemap/4/algorithm/10.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181

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/three.js/2.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Algorithm 在队列中呈现实体?_Algorithm_Rendering_Game Engine - Fatal编程技术网

Algorithm 在队列中呈现实体?

Algorithm 在队列中呈现实体?,algorithm,rendering,game-engine,Algorithm,Rendering,Game Engine,我正在研究游戏引擎架构,我遇到了一个实现,其中场景图中的每个节点都被放置在一个特定的队列中(不透明、透明、正交等),队列以特定的顺序呈现:不透明、透明、正交。这种技术/算法有没有名字可供进一步研究 非常感谢 我不知道您提到的整体排序是否有一个名称,但我假设透明队列是从最远到最近排序的,这称为Alpha排序(or)。不透明对象不需要这样做,因此它们可以先进行排序,也可以与透明对象一起进行排序,但不费心对它们进行排序显然更快,因为您可以让深度缓冲区用于所有相关工作

我正在研究游戏引擎架构,我遇到了一个实现,其中场景图中的每个节点都被放置在一个特定的队列中(不透明、透明、正交等),队列以特定的顺序呈现:不透明、透明、正交。这种技术/算法有没有名字可供进一步研究


非常感谢

我不知道您提到的整体排序是否有一个名称,但我假设透明队列是从最远到最近排序的,这称为Alpha排序(or)。不透明对象不需要这样做,因此它们可以先进行排序,也可以与透明对象一起进行排序,但不费心对它们进行排序显然更快,因为您可以让深度缓冲区用于所有相关工作